1. Immediate Side Effects Post-Pearl Laser Treatment

Immediately following a Pearl Laser treatment session, patients may experience redness, swelling, and mild discomfort, similar to a sunburn. These symptoms are typically temporary and can last for a few days. It is crucial to follow post-treatment care instructions provided by your dermatologist to minimize these effects and promote healing. Application of prescribed creams and avoiding direct sun exposure can help alleviate these symptoms.

2. Long-term Side Effects and Risks

While Pearl Laser treatment is generally safe, there are potential long-term side effects that patients should be aware of. These include changes in skin pigmentation, either hypopigmentation (lightening of the skin) or hyperpigmentation (darkening of the skin). These changes can be temporary or permanent, depending on individual skin types and adherence to post-treatment care. Scarring is another rare but possible side effect, especially if the treatment is not performed by a qualified professional or if proper aftercare is neglected.

3. Side Effects Based on Skin Type and Color

The side effects of Pearl Laser treatment can vary significantly based on the patient's skin type and color. Individuals with darker skin tones are at a higher risk of pigmentation changes. It is essential for practitioners in Chaguanas to adjust the laser settings according to the patient's skin type to minimize these risks. Consulting with a dermatologist who has experience with various skin types is advisable to ensure safe and effective treatment.

4. Management of Side Effects

Effective management of side effects post-Pearl Laser treatment involves a combination of professional advice and self-care practices. Regular follow-up appointments with your dermatologist are crucial to monitor healing and address any concerns promptly. Over-the-counter pain relievers can help manage discomfort, and cool compresses can reduce swelling. Ensuring proper hydration and a healthy diet also supports the healing process.

5. Preventative Measures to Minimize Side Effects

Taking preventative measures can significantly reduce the risk of side effects from Pearl Laser treatment. These include choosing a reputable clinic with experienced practitioners, ensuring thorough pre-treatment consultations, and strictly adhering to post-treatment care instructions. Using high-SPF sunscreen and protective clothing to avoid sun exposure is vital to prevent skin damage and pigmentation issues.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How long do the side effects of Pearl Laser treatment last?

A: Immediate side effects like redness and swelling typically last for a few days to a week. Long-term side effects, if any, depend on individual skin conditions and adherence to post-treatment care.

Q: Can Pearl Laser treatment be performed on all skin types?

A: Yes, Pearl Laser treatment can be performed on various skin types, but adjustments in laser settings are necessary to minimize risks, especially for darker skin tones.

Q: Is Pearl Laser treatment painful?

A: Patients may experience mild discomfort during the procedure, which is often described as a sensation similar to a rubber band snapping against the skin. Topical anesthetics can be used to manage pain.

Q: How can I choose the right practitioner for Pearl Laser treatment?

A: Look for a practitioner with extensive experience in laser treatments, particularly with patients of similar skin types. Reviews and recommendations from previous patients can also be helpful in making your decision.
